Critically acclaimed novelist Chad Dundas and award-winning longtime combat sports journalist Jonathan Snowden on Monday announced a new joint venture: THE TERRITORIES, a sprawling shared- world fiction universe set in the glitzy and gaudy world of professional wrestling during the 1980s.

THE TERRITORIES will feature an ongoing series of connected short stories, novels, novellas and more from a rotating group of writers. The stories will span multiple genres and styles, but will all take place in the same world, comprised of 16 fictional regional wrestling promotions and starring an ensemble cast of colorful figures. THE TERRITORIES will be simultaneously recognizable to wrestling fans while offering readers a bold new vision of the wrestling world.

Volume One will be published on Aug. 1, 2022 and features 10 short stories by a group of established writers as well as a novella written by Chad Dundas. Dundas’ work THE BIG HOSS follows a struggling rookie wrestler being mentored by an aging star in decline as the two travel the backroads of rural Montana, performing in cramped high school gyms and dusty rodeo arenas, one hoping to catch his first big break, the other hoping for his last.

Volume one contributors include award-winning authors Nick Mamatas, Carrie Laben and Jason Ridler, noted sportswriter and podcaster Ben Fowlkes, New York Times Magazine contributor Dan Brooks, FOX television series “The Great North” writer Kevin Seccia, acclaimed young adult novelist Richard Fifield and more.

ABOUT THE SERIES EDITORS

Chad Dundas is the author of the novels The Blaze and Champion of the World. He has worked as a sportswriter for ESPN, The Athletic, Bleacher Report and the Associated Press, among others. He is co- host of the Co-Main Event MMA Podcast and an executive producer on the history and true crime podcast Death in the West. He lives in Missoula, Montana with his wife and children.

Jonathan Snowden is the author of Shamrock: The World’s Most Dangerous Man, Total MMA, The MMA Encyclopedia and Shooters: The Toughest Men in Professional Wrestling. He works for the Department of Defense and lives in Alabama with his wife and two children.
